>> My bank lets me download monthly reports as CSV. In fact they let me
>> choose the separator and the default value is the comma. But I choose
>> '|' because then I can open the csv as org file and just do
>>
>> (replace-regexp "^" "|")
>>
>> to get a beautiful org-mode table.
>
> There is an easier org-mode way I think.  Just get the comma delimited
> data into your org file, select the region and C-c | to get your table.
>
> If you are inserting an external file with C-x i <file> RET
> then C-x C-x marks the region and C-c | converts it to a table.
